An entry-level role focusing on the execution of integrated marketing campaigns across multiple channels. Graduates apply their organizational skills to manage content calendars, coordinate with creative teams, and track basic performance metrics to ensure campaign alignment with business goals.
Supports the social media team by creating engaging content, scheduling posts, and monitoring community interactions. Business administration freshers leverage their understanding of consumer behavior to analyze engagement trends and assist in developing strategies that enhance brand presence and audience loyalty.
Focuses on improving website visibility through search engine optimization techniques such as keyword research and on-page optimization. Freshers use their analytical skills to audit site performance, conduct competitor analysis, and implement technical adjustments that drive organic traffic and improve search rankings.
Responsible for planning and producing valuable content that attracts and retains a target audience. Business graduates apply their strategic thinking to align content topics with business objectives, ensuring that blogs, whitepapers, and videos support the overall sales funnel and brand messaging.
Manages email campaigns, segments audiences, and analyzes open and click-through rates to optimize performance. Freshers utilize their data interpretation skills to test subject lines and layouts, ensuring effective communication strategies that nurture leads and drive customer retention.
Assists in managing pay-per-click campaigns on platforms like Google Ads and Bing. Business administration graduates apply their budgeting and ROI analysis skills to monitor bids, adjust targeting parameters, and report on cost-efficiency to maximize advertising spend and generate qualified leads.
Supports the marketing team by collecting, cleaning, and visualizing data from various digital channels. Freshers leverage their statistical knowledge to interpret campaign performance, identify trends, and provide actionable insights that help leadership make informed strategic decisions based on hard data.
Helps maintain brand consistency across all digital touchpoints and marketing materials. Business graduates apply their understanding of brand equity and positioning to ensure that digital assets align with corporate identity guidelines, supporting long-term brand value and market recognition.
Manages relationships with affiliate partners and tracks referral traffic and sales conversions. Freshers use their negotiation and relationship management skills to recruit new partners, negotiate commission structures, and analyze performance data to optimize the affiliate program's profitability.
Focuses on the technical and operational aspects of marketing technology stacks and automation. Business administration graduates apply their process improvement skills to streamline workflows, manage CRM integration, and ensure data accuracy, allowing the marketing team to operate more efficiently and scale effectively.
Supports growth hacking initiatives by testing new channels and experiments to accelerate user acquisition. Freshers apply their problem-solving and analytical abilities to run A/B tests, analyze conversion funnels, and identify low-hanging fruit for rapid business growth and customer expansion.
Identifies, vets, and manages relationships with social media influencers for brand collaborations. Business graduates leverage their networking and contract negotiation skills to align influencer partnerships with brand values, ensuring campaigns deliver measurable ROI and authentic audience engagement.
Analyzes customer journey data to identify pain points and opportunities for improvement in the digital experience. Freshers use their business acumen to correlate customer feedback with sales data, providing recommendations for optimizing website usability and enhancing overall customer satisfaction.
Assists in crafting and distributing consistent messages across various digital and traditional media channels. Business administration graduates apply their strategic communication principles to ensure that all marketing collateral supports the company's broader business objectives and resonates with target demographics.
Focuses on improving website performance by analyzing user behavior and testing design elements. Freshers apply their analytical skills to interpret heatmaps and user flows, suggesting changes to landing pages that reduce bounce rates and increase the percentage of visitors who take desired actions.
Manages product listings, promotions, and ad campaigns specifically for online stores. Business graduates leverage their understanding of retail dynamics and consumer psychology to optimize product pages, manage inventory-based marketing, and drive online sales through targeted digital strategies.
Plans and oversees the production of video content for digital platforms like YouTube and social media. Freshers apply their project management skills to coordinate filming schedules, edit raw footage, and ensure that video content aligns with brand guidelines and marketing campaign goals.
Builds and engages with an online community around a brand or product. Business administration graduates use their interpersonal and strategic skills to moderate discussions, respond to inquiries, and foster a sense of belonging among users, turning customers into brand advocates.
